Compare Eastchester to Holtsville
This post compares Eastchester, New York to Holtsville, New York across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.
Dimension | Eastchester (CDP) | Holtsville (CDP) |
---|---|---|
Population | 20,099 | 20,201 |
Income (median) | $83,834 | $61,023 |
Home Value (median) | $583,100 | $350,100 |
White | 87% | 89% |
Black | 1% | 3% |
Asian | 7% | 3% |
With Kids | 30% | 36% |
Age (median) | 43 | 41 |
Rentals | 19% | 20% |
